1. A Business Bank Account Helps You Stay Organized
One of the biggest benefits of a business bank account is that it keeps your money organized. When your personal funds and business funds are mixed together, it becomes very hard to track what money belongs to you and what money belongs to the business.
With a business account:
-
You know exactly how much your business earns
-
You can easily track expenses
-
You avoid confusion during tax season
This financial clarity helps you make smarter decisions and reduces mistakes.
2. It Makes Your Business Look More Professional
Another important benefit of a business bank account is professionalism. When customers or clients pay into a personal account, it looks less trustworthy. But when they pay into a business account, it gives your business credibility.
A business account also allows you to:
-
Receive payments in your business name
-
Issue invoices professionally
-
Improve how customers see your brand
In business, trust is everything, and a business account helps build that trust.
3. It Helps You Separate Business and Personal Expenses
Mixing personal spending with business spending is one of the most common mistakes business owners make. A key benefit of a business bank account is being able to separate these two areas of your life.
Separating your money helps you:
-
Know the true cost of running your business
-
Track profits accurately
-
Avoid overspending
When your expenses are clear, budgeting and planning become easier.
4. It Simplifies Taxes and Accounting
Tax season is stressful for many business owners, especially those who do not have a proper financial system. Another strong benefit of a business bank account is that it makes tax filing easier.
With all your business transactions in one account, your accountant (or you) can easily:
-
Identify business income
-
Track deductible expenses
-
Prepare financial statements
This reduces errors and keeps you compliant with tax laws something every business must take seriously.
5. It Gives You Access to Better Financial Services
A major benefit of a business bank account is access to financial opportunities you cannot get with a personal account. Banks offer special services to businesses, such as:
-
Business loans
-
Overdrafts
-
Credit facilities
-
Business savings plans
-
Merchant services for receiving payments
These services help your business grow, expand, and manage cash flow better.
With a business bank account, banks take your business more seriously and are more willing to support you financially.
